This Falcon 50 was build in 2001, test flown with tailnumber F-WWHU, allocated tailnumber N668P on 15 November 2001, and delivered to Conoco Phillips in November 2001. On 20 Februari 2007 this regi was cancelled with the FAA and the aircraft was exported to the Netherlands. On 22 May 2007 tailnumber PH-LSV was reserved by Verwelius Holding bv / SolidaiR. The Falcon 50EX was registered to SolidaiR on 28 March 2007 with tailnumber PH- LSV. The Falcon was delivered to Schiphol on 7-7-7, or 7 July 2007. Five years later the Falcon was offered for sale: [ttaf:2655] & [$8.600.000] On 25 May 2012 the Falcon was cancelled from the Dutch civil aircraft register and exported to Luxembourg with tailnumber LX-LXL.
